z28th1s 01-28-2012 04:47 PM

1st question: Not enough info to make a good decision???

What year 4.6?
What gears and tires are on your car?
From a dig or a roll?

Your 2nd question: You have a '88 Mustang which came from the factory with speed density. Has your car been converted to mass air? If not, that is most likely your idle problem.
